Description

OAZ2 encodes ornithine decarboxylase antizyme 2, a protein that negatively regulates polyamine biosynthesis by binding to ornithine decarboxylase (ODC) and targeting it for ubiquitin-independent proteasomal degradation. It also inhibits polyamine uptake and is involved in cell cycle regulation and apoptosis. Expression is induced by high polyamine levels via a unique ribosomal frameshifting mechanism.

Protein Summary

OAZ2 is a 228-amino acid protein (UniProt O95190) that functions as an antizyme, binding to ornithine decarboxylase (ODC) to inhibit its enzymatic activity and promote its degradation. It also inhibits polyamine transport. The protein is expressed in multiple tissues, with highest levels in testis. Its activity is regulated by polyamine-induced ribosomal frameshifting.
